Electrical stimulation boosts seed germination, seedling growth, and thermotolerance improvement in maize (Zea mays L.)
Electrical signaling, similar to chemical signalings such as calcium (Ca(2+)), reactive oxygen species (ROS, mainly hydrogen peroxide: H(2)O(2)), nitric oxide (NO), and hydrogen sulfide (H(2)S), regulates many physiological processes.
